Parents Magazine Record-A-Voice Toy Phones Are Recalled

By: Shannon Bruffett
Updated: June 14, 2007
cell2007-05-10-1178802130.jpgBattat is recalling about 300,000 Parents® Magazine Record-A-Voice toy cell phones. The metal pin inside the hinge of the cell phone flip-top can fall out, posing a choking hazard to young children. The toy cell phone plays different songs, sound effects and user recorded messages. They were sold in polka dot, swirl, floral and stripe patterns, and the Parents logo is visible inside the flip-top and on the battery compartment cover. Only items bearing date codes 090106 through 101206 are involved in this recall. The date code can be located on the bottom of the product packaging and in the battery compartment. They were sold at Target stores nationwide from September 2006 to January 2007 for about $8. Consumers should take these toy cell phones away from young children immediately and contact battat to receive a replacement product or refund.
